Web10 Jan 2024 · The growth rate of your variegated Pothos will depend on the level of variegation. As heavily variegated varieties contain far less chlorophyll than others, less photosynthesis occurs, slowing the growth rate. Web24 Apr 2024 · Satin pothos plants experience the best growth in a temperature range of 65°F to 85°F (18°C – 29°C). Constant average room temperature is similar to their native tropical environment. To grow well, protect the plants from sudden changes in temperature. It can be challenging to get the right temperature in summer or winter. Web3 Feb 2024 · Browning on a snow queen pothos leaf Snow queen pothos growth rate & repotting needs. As a variegated plant, snow queen pothos is generally a slower grower—at least when compared to some of its relatives, which grow like absolute weeds. (And in some cases grow so prolifically that they have become invasive, like some areas in Florida.)
